Winter is coming to an end, meaning all the temperate reptiles get their heat turned back on and can start coming out for handling.
Nimona here is the first to get handled again; she’s a hybrid black pine x bullsnake, and got the quiet demeanor of her mother with a lot of the color of her father (though she keeps getting darker so this could rapidly change). Like a lot of my snakes, she occasionally likes trying to burrow through my hair…

#snakes nice Mother's Day surprise. Haven't seen a gopher snake in awhile. They are weclome visitors. Don't kill them. They eat rodents. #gardening #gophersnake. Before I noticed him he was laying flat but coiled and mimiced a rattlesnake to get me to bsck off. This one was about 3+ feet.

There were two baby flycatchers (Say's Phoebe) near where this snake was. One of the parent birds had been calling and I thought it was a cat around or just the chickens causing it. There's a stack of junk below the nest to prevent the cats (in the night mostly), but I didn't expect a snake could be an issue. Maybe this has always been a thing because they've seem to have lost the babies quite often it seems like.

It was escorted to the tall grass.
